...
This flowchart illustrates how version increments propagate through different levels of the FOLIO/Eureka ecosystem—from individual modules (UI or back-end) up to the encompassing application and platform. Each decision (patch, minor, or major) at the module level triggers a corresponding version bump at the application and platform layers. This ensures consistency and compatibility across all components, so that any change in underlying modules is accurately reflected in the application’s and, ultimately, the platform’s version.
Drawio | ||||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
|
Modules flow
...
Applications flow
...
This diagram shows the final step of merging a pull request in the platform-lsp repository. After the PR is reviewed and approved, notifies the team (e.g., via Slack). This confirms the updated platform descriptor as the official release, ensuring all changes are properly recorded and communicated.
Drawio | ||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
|
...
Pull Request Merge Flow: Once approved, the pull request is merged into the release branch. The workflow notifies the team, confirming the updated platform descriptor as an official release.
Drawio | ||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
|